




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数智创新变革未来分布式服务器系统分布式服务器系统概述分布式系统的基础架构服务器间的通信与协调负载均衡与资源管理故障恢复与容错处理数据安全与一致性保障性能优化与监控分布式系统未来发展趋势ContentsPage目录页分布式服务器系统概述分布式服务器系统分布式服务器系统概述1.定义和构成:分布式服务器系统是由多台服务器通过网络连接,协同工作,共同提供服务的系统。这些服务器在地理位置上可以分散,但在逻辑上是一个整体。2.工作原理:分布式服务器系统利用分布式计算和资源共享的原理,将多个独立的服务器整合在一起,形成一个具有高性能、高可用性、高可扩展性的系统。3.主要特点:分布式服务器系统具有高度的可靠性、可用性和可扩展性。由于服务器之间可以互相备份和协同工作,因此系统整体性能较高,且能够随着需求的增长而灵活扩展。分布式服务器系统的优势1.提高性能:通过分布式架构,可以整合多台服务器的计算资源,提高系统的整体性能。2.增强可靠性:分布式服务器系统中的服务器可以互相备份,当某台服务器出现故障时,其他服务器可以接管其工作,保证系统的可靠性。3.可扩展性:随着业务需求的增长,可以通过添加更多的服务器来扩展系统的处理能力。分布式服务器系统概述分布式服务器系统概述分布式服务器系统的应用1.云计算:分布式服务器系统是云计算的核心组成部分,为各种云计算服务提供基础架构支持。2.大数据处理:分布式服务器系统能够处理大量的数据,为数据分析、挖掘和应用提供支持。3.互联网应用:许多互联网应用,如搜索引擎、社交媒体等,都使用分布式服务器系统来提高性能和可扩展性。以上内容仅供参考,具体内容可以根据您的需求进行调整优化。分布式系统的基础架构分布式服务器系统分布式系统的基础架构1.分布式系统的基础架构包括硬件、操作系统、通信协议和应用程序等多个组件,这些组件协同工作,实现系统的分布式特性。2.在分布式系统中,各个节点之间通过网络连接,形成一个统一的系统,因此网络通信是分布式系统的基础架构中不可或缺的一部分。为了保证系统的可靠性和稳定性,需要选择合适的通信协议和网络拓扑结构。3.分布式系统的基础架构需要支持节点的动态加入和离开,以及负载均衡和容错处理等功能。这需要设计合适的算法和协议,以满足系统的可扩展性和可靠性需求。分布式系统的硬件架构1.分布式系统的硬件架构包括多个计算节点和存储设备,这些设备通过网络连接,形成一个统一的系统。因此,选择合适的计算节点和存储设备,以及网络拓扑结构,对于提高系统的性能和可靠性至关重要。2.在分布式系统的硬件架构中,需要考虑节点的可扩展性、容错性和可维护性。这需要设计合适的硬件架构和接口,以满足系统的需求和方便维护。分布式系统的基础架构分布式系统的基础架构分布式系统的操作系统1.分布式系统的操作系统需要支持分布式特性,能够管理多个节点和资源,并提供统一的接口和服务。2.分布式系统的操作系统需要具有可靠性和稳定性,能够保证系统的正常运行和数据的一致性。这需要设计合适的算法和协议,以确保系统的可靠性和稳定性。分布式系统的通信协议1.在分布式系统中,各个节点之间需要通过通信协议进行信息交互和协同工作。因此,选择合适的通信协议对于提高系统的性能和可靠性至关重要。2.分布式系统的通信协议需要具有可扩展性和容错性,能够处理大量的节点和消息,并保证消息的正确传输和处理。分布式系统的基础架构分布式系统的应用程序架构1.分布式系统的应用程序架构需要支持分布式特性,能够将应用程序分割为多个模块,并部署在不同的节点上运行。2.分布式系统的应用程序架构需要考虑负载均衡和容错处理等问题,以保证应用程序的高可用性和可伸缩性。这需要设计合适的算法和协议,以优化应用程序的性能和可靠性。以上是对分布式系统的基础架构的一些主题和的介绍,这些要点对于理解和设计分布式系统具有重要的指导意义。服务器间的通信与协调分布式服务器系统服务器间的通信与协调服务器间通信协议1.通信协议的选择应根据具体的应用场景和需求,例如TCP协议适用于可靠传输,UDP协议适用于实时性要求高的场景。2.服务器间通信协议需要具备可扩展性,以支持大规模分布式系统的需求。3.随着技术的发展,一些新的通信协议如gRPC、ApacheThrift等也逐渐在分布式系统中得到应用。消息队列1.消息队列是实现异步通信和解耦的重要手段,可以降低系统间的耦合性。2.消息队列需要具备高可用性、可扩展性和消息持久化等特性。3.常见的消息队列产品有RabbitMQ、Kafka等。服务器间的通信与协调1.负载均衡可以有效分配系统资源,提高系统的整体性能和稳定性。2.负载均衡算法的选择应根据具体的应用场景和需求,例如轮询、随机、加权等算法。3.一些负载均衡产品如Nginx、HAProxy等得到了广泛的应用。服务注册与发现1.服务注册与发现可以实现动态服务管理和服务寻址,提高系统的可扩展性和可用性。2.常见的服务注册与发现产品有Consul、Eureka等。3.服务注册与发现需要具备高可用性、故障恢复等特性。负载均衡服务器间的通信与协调分布式事务1.分布式事务需要保证多个节点之间的数据一致性和完整性。2.分布式事务可以采用两阶段提交、三阶段提交等协议来实现。3.一些新的分布式事务方案如TCC、Saga等也逐渐得到应用。安全性1.服务器间通信需要保证数据传输的安全性和完整性,可以采用SSL/TLS等加密协议。2.需要对服务器间的访问进行身份认证和权限控制,可以采用OAuth、JWT等认证机制。3.需要定期对服务器间的通信进行安全审计和漏洞扫描,确保系统的安全性。以上是关于《分布式服务器系统》中"服务器间的通信与协调"章节的简报PPT主题名称和,供您参考。负载均衡与资源管理分布式服务器系统负载均衡与资源管理负载均衡算法与优化1.常见的负载均衡算法:轮询、随机、加权轮询、加权随机等,以及它们的适用场景和优缺点。2.负载均衡优化技术:动态权重调整、预测性负载均衡、应用层负载均衡等,以提高系统性能和响应速度。3.结合云计算和大数据技术,实现智能化的负载均衡,提高资源利用率和服务质量。资源管理与分配1.资源管理的基本原则:公平、高效、可控,确保系统资源的合理分配和利用。2.资源分配策略:基于优先级、基于负载、基于性能等分配策略,以满足不同业务需求。3.资源隔离与限制:通过容器化、虚拟化等技术,实现资源的隔离和限制,提高系统稳定性和安全性。负载均衡与资源管理弹性伸缩与自动化1.弹性伸缩的原理和实现方式:根据系统负载变化,动态调整服务器数量和资源分配。2.自动化管理工具和技术:监控、告警、自动化脚本等,提高系统管理和维护效率。3.结合云计算和大数据技术,实现智能化的弹性伸缩和自动化管理。服务质量与性能监测1.服务质量指标:响应时间、吞吐量、错误率等,以及它们的测量和评估方法。2.性能监测工具和技术:实时监控、性能分析、压力测试等,以及它们的应用场景和使用方法。3.结合大数据和人工智能技术,实现智能化的服务质量与性能监测和优化。负载均衡与资源管理安全与风险管理1.安全风险:DDoS攻击、注入攻击、跨站脚本等安全威胁,以及它们的防范措施。2.安全管理:身份验证、访问控制、数据加密等安全措施,以确保系统安全。3.风险评估与应急预案:定期进行风险评估,制定应急预案,提高系统可靠性和抗灾能力。绿色计算与可持续发展1.绿色计算理念:节能减排、资源再利用、环保等,推动信息系统可持续发展。2.绿色计算技术:虚拟化、云计算、数据中心节能技术等,降低系统能耗和提高资源利用率。3.结合循环经济和碳排放管理,实现信息系统的绿色化和可持续发展。故障恢复与容错处理分布式服务器系统故障恢复与容错处理故障检测与定位1.快速准确的故障检测:通过实时监控系统状态,及时发现异常行为,防止故障扩散。2.故障定位:利用日志分析和性能数据,确定故障组件和服务,为恢复操作提供准确信息。备份与恢复策略1.数据备份:定期备份关键数据,确保在故障发生时能快速恢复数据完整性。2.恢复策略:制定详细的恢复步骤和应急预案,确保在系统故障时迅速恢复正常服务。故障恢复与容错处理容错机制设计1.冗余设计:为关键组件和服务提供冗余资源,确保在系统部分故障时,服务能继续正常运行。2.负载均衡:通过负载均衡技术,合理分配系统资源,防止单点故障的发生。动态扩展与缩容1.动态扩展:在系统负载增加时,能够自动或手动扩展资源,满足性能需求。2.缩容:在系统负载降低时,自动或手动缩减资源,节省成本并提高资源利用率。故障恢复与容错处理监控与预警系统1.实时监控:对系统性能和关键指标进行实时监控,及时发现潜在问题。2.预警机制:预设阈值和触发条件,对潜在问题进行预警,提前采取应对措施。应急响应与协同机制1.应急响应:建立应急响应团队,对突发事件进行快速响应和处理。2.协同机制:各部门之间建立协同机制,确保在故障恢复过程中能够高效配合,降低故障影响。数据安全与一致性保障分布式服务器系统数据安全与一致性保障数据安全与一致性保障的概述1.分布式系统数据安全的重要性:确保数据的完整性、机密性和可用性。2.一致性的挑战:在分布式环境下,多个服务器节点需要协同工作,保证数据的一致性。3.数据安全与一致性保障的常见技术和方法:加密、访问控制、数据备份、数据同步等。数据加密1.数据加密的原理:通过加密算法将明文数据转换为密文数据,确保数据的机密性。2.常见的加密算法:对称加密算法、非对称加密算法和哈希函数等。3.数据加密在分布式系统中的应用:数据传输加密、数据存储加密等。数据安全与一致性保障访问控制1.访问控制的必要性:防止未经授权的访问,保护数据安全。2.访问控制的方法:身份验证、权限管理、角色管理等。3.在分布式系统中实现访问控制:通过访问控制列表、能力列表等技术实现。数据备份与恢复1.数据备份的重要性:防止数据丢失,保障数据的可用性。2.数据备份的策略:完全备份、增量备份、差异备份等。3.数据恢复的方法:根据备份数据进行恢复,确保数据的完整性。数据安全与一致性保障数据同步与一致性协议1.数据同步的实现方式:主从复制、多主复制等。2.常见的一致性协议:Paxos、Raft等。3.数据同步与一致性协议在分布式系统中的应用:确保多个节点之间的数据一致性。新兴技术与数据安全1.新兴技术对数据安全的影响:区块链、人工智能、量子计算等技术的发展为数据安全带来新的挑战和机遇。2.区块链在数据安全中的应用:通过去中心化的特性,提高数据的机密性和完整性。3.人工智能和量子计算在数据安全中的潜力:通过智能算法和强大的计算能力,提高数据加密和破解的能力。性能优化与监控分布式服务器系统性能优化与监控分布式服务器系统性能优化1.分布式架构优化:通过合理的分布式架构设计,提高系统的可扩展性和稳定性,进而提升系统性能。2.资源调度优化:通过智能资源调度算法,合理分配计算、存储和网络资源,避免资源争用和浪费。3.并行计算优化:利用并行计算技术,将大任务分解为多个小任务并发处理,提高系统整体处理能力。分布式服务器系统性能监控1.数据采集与分析:实时采集系统性能数据,进行分析和可视化展示,帮助管理员了解系统性能状况。2.异常检测与预警:通过机器学习等技术,实时检测系统性能异常,并进行预警,以便及时处理问题。3.性能优化建议:根据性能数据分析结果,提供针对性的性能优化建议,帮助管理员进行系统调优。以上内容仅供参考,具体性能优化和监控方案需要根据实际的分布式服务器系统情况和需求进行设计。分布式系统未来发展趋势分布式服务器系统分布式系统未来发展趋势云计算的进一步发展1.云计算将成为分布式系统的主要驱动力,提供更高效、灵活的资源共享和数据处理能力。2.随着5G、6G网络的普及,边缘计算将与云计算更紧密结合,形成更强大的分布式系统。3.人工智能和机器学习在云计算中的应用将进一步提升分布式系统的智能化水平和自动化管理能力。区块链技术的融合应用1.区块链技术为分布式系统提供了更高的安全性和透明度,将促进分布式系统的可信度和可靠性。2.区块链与分布式系统的结合将推动去中心化应用的发展,促进数据的共享和保护。3.区块链技术可以提高分布式系统的可扩展性和性能,为大规模应用提供支持。分布式系统未来发展趋势1.物联网设备将成为分布式系统的重要组成部分,提供更多数据源和计算能力。2.物联网设备间的通信和协同工作将依赖于高效的分布式系统。3.物联网技术的发展将推动分布式系统的智能化和自适应能力。绿色计算和可持续发展1.分布式系统将更加注重能源效率和资源利用率,减少能耗和碳排放。2.可再生能源和清洁能源的利用将提高分布式系统的环保性。3.
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025贵州黔东南州剑河县顺诚公司紧急招聘长期搔菌人员15人模拟试卷附答案详解(突破训练)
- 2025年宿州市人才集团有限公司招募就业见习人员7人模拟试卷及答案详解(历年真题)
- 2025年贵阳市市级机关公开遴选考试真题
- 2025甘肃省计量研究院聘用人员招聘8人考前自测高频考点模拟试题及完整答案详解一套
- 2025贵州天柱县第二季度(第一次)拟招聘8个全日制城镇公益性岗位模拟试卷含答案详解
- 2025年春季中国光大银行济南分行校园招聘(滨州有岗)模拟试卷附答案详解(黄金题型)
- 2025北京中国热带农业科学院椰子研究所第一批次招聘模拟试卷附答案详解(突破训练)
- 2025贵州黔南州瓮安县“雁归兴瓮”人才引进模拟试卷及1套参考答案详解
- 2025广东佛山市中心血站南海血站招聘公益一类事业编制工作人员2人模拟试卷及答案详解参考
- 2025广东中山翠亨集团有限公司副总经理选聘1人考前自测高频考点模拟试题参考答案详解
- 南海特产与美食课件
- 《三国演义》中的心理描写:以司马懿为例
- 迪尔凯姆社会学主义的巨擎汇总课件
- 家庭经济困难学生认定申请表
- 血栓性血小板减少性紫癜ttp汇编课件
- 阀门安装及阀门安装施工方案
- 大学数学《实变函数》电子教案
- YY/T 0640-2008无源外科植入物通用要求
- GB/T 2637-2016安瓿
- 数轴上的动点问题课件
- 省级公开课(一等奖)雨巷-戴望舒课件
评论
0/150
提交评论